5 sports cars you can buy in Pakistan

Living in a country like Pakistan where brutal taxation has made car prices skyrocket, owning a sports car has become a dream or at least they think so (and no i am not talking about the Honda Civic). To prove them wrong, here is the list of 5 sports cars which will do 200+ km/h without breaking a sweat.

5. Honda CR-Z:

Okay I might get a lot of bashing for this from car guys but hear me out. The reason why this car is here is not because of its engine or the body shape (Which both are not so great) but the real reason it is here is because it i really gives you a sporty feel. I have driven this car and it just so toss-able. If you are the kind of guy who would enjoy a drive on the Murree express way on a Sunday, this car will surely put a smile on your face. It has a 1.5L Petrol engine and a hybrid electric motor. Collectively, they produce around 120hp. Yes I know that isn't much but tuning the ECU will help you gain at least 20 more hp. The car is light and is fun to drive around with that 6-speed manual gearbox(The CVT is horrible). With the price range of around 16-17 lacs for mint condition.

4. Mazda RX-8:

No car list will ever be complete without mentioning a rotary engine. This rev happy monster is another great Sunday driver and it is not slow. Comes with a 1.3L rotary engine which produces roughly 220hp. and will happily rev up to 8500 RPM. The car has a bad reputation for unreliability but if it is your weekend car(Drive your Mehran for the rest of the week), you will not get in trouble that often. With a top speed of 240 km/h and a 6 speed manual, it will give you something to smile about even on the straight road. The car will do 0-100 in less than 6 seconds. Yes the fuel economy is terrible and and the maintenance cost will put a hole in your wallet but the driving experience will make you forget all of it flaws. Seriously, drive one and you will know what I am talking about. A 2003ish model will sell for around 12-14 lacs and a more recent 2011ish will sell for 24 and above.

3. Honda S2000:

The Honda S2000. That's all you need to say to any car guy and they will suddenly get excited. Coming up on number 3 is an exhilarating Go-carty kinda car which became the definition of the Vtec. The S2000 might just be the most fun car to drive here on our list. With only 2 seats, it is a very "drivers car" since is doesn't even feature climate control knobs for the passenger. It has a 2.0L engine producing a staggering 240+ hp coupled with a 6-speed manual for a car that weighs less than 1300kg. This resulted in a car that has a top speed of 270km/h. The best thing I really like about this car is the feeling when Vtec kicks in at around 4500 RPM. The best part is that it is a Honda and a very reliable vehicle. You can get an S2000 for around 20-25 lacs.

2. Nissan 350z:

The Nissan 350z is arguably the best stock sports car you can buy in Pakistan. The 350z is the younger cousin of THE GTR itself. With the 3.5L V6 monster under the hood, it produces 300+ HP from factory. Install a Twin turbo kit to that and you can achieve 600 or more HP from this monster.I personally am in love with this car. Comes with a 6 speed manual gearbox and a top speed of 250+ km/h.The 350z is available in Pakistan with prices ranging from 24-30 lacs depending on the model year.

1. Toyota Supra:

The most favorite sports car for tuners in Pakistan, The Toyota Supra is the most talked about car when it comes to crazy horsepower numbers. Equipped with the legendary 2JZ engine producing a power output of 220HP for the base and 320HP for the turbo one pushing the car to around 250 km/h limited electronically. Without the limiter, it will easily touch 280+ km/h. Although it is hard to find a stock supra, a stock one will sell for around 25+ lacs. Since people have done crazy stuff to it, a 500HP supra recently was sold for around 40 lacs in Islamabad.

To sum it up, You can have an excellent weekend vehicle for less than 30 lacs. That is cheaper than the new Honda Civic or a Toyota Prius.
